Trinidad and Tobago - Import of Prepared or Preserved Palm Hearts
Since 2014, Trinidad and Tobago Import of Prepared or Preserved Palm Hearts jumped by 3% year on year. With $9,041 in 2019, the country was ranked number 64 among other countries in Import of Prepared or Preserved Palm Hearts. Trinidad and Tobago is overtaken by Bangladesh, which was ranked number 63 with $10,463 and is followed by Romania with $8,045.51. France topped the ranking with $29,525,175.96 in 2019, that is a decrease of 2.6% compared to 2018. United States, Chile and Argentina resp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. India witnessed the best average annual growth at +132% per year, while Hungary witnessed the worst performance at -69.4% per year.
